LAWS75-321: Bookkeeping and Trust Accounts

Description

Bookkeeping and Trust Accounts is a compulsory subject in the Juris Doctor program offered by the Faculty of Law.  This 5 credit point subject examines the statutory rules applicable to the operation of trust accounts in a legal practice. Students will receive practical training in basic bookkeeping for responsible legal practice.
